1492  ·  Metallstift und Feder in Braun auf Pergament  ·  Image ID: 1700141

Early Renaissance

The Divine Comedy, Paradiso VII. Second Planetary Sphere (Heaven of Mercury): Beatrice Introduces Dante to Complex Questions of Divine Justice and Human Original Sin and Redemption Through Christ's Death by Sandro Botticelli. Available as an art print on canvas, photo paper, watercolor board, natural paper, or Japanese paper.
Staatliche Museen zu Berlin
